Customer Success Manager

6 hours ago


Philippines Far Out Scout Full time ₱1,200,000 - ₱2,400,000 per year

Role Overview

The client is hiring a Customer Success Manager who will take over right after Sales closes a deal and guide clients through deployment, onboarding, adoption, and ongoing success.

This role blends customer success + account management + operations coordination, ensuring deployments run smoothly and clients stay engaged, supported, and satisfied. You'll be the one keeping customers happy, processes organized, and technology fully utilized.

What You'll Do

Customer Success and Account Management

  • Take ownership of client relationships after the Sales handoff
  • Manage pre-deployment checklists and track deployment progress
  • Lead 30-day and 60-day post-deployment check-ins
  • Host monthly calls with key clients
  • Drive product adoption and robot utilization
  • Communicate feature updates and enhancements
  • Identify upsell opportunities
  • Conduct post-deployment refresher training
  • Gather customer feedback and relay product feature requests

Support and Issue Management

  • Provide Tier 1 support for key clients
  • Triage issues to Support/Engineering when needed
  • Monitor error logs and vendor portals
  • Ensure consistent login and usage in intelligence/robot portals
  • Track customer pain points and recurring issues

Operations and Coordination

  • Manage the deployment calendar (deployments, conferences, sales fulfillment)
  • Coordinate with internal teams to keep timelines on track
  • Maintain clean documentation, account notes, and deployment updates
  • Utilize AI for scheduling support, data extraction, checklist automation, and reporting
Requirements
  • 3+ years in Customer Success, Account Management, Operations, or of similar capacity
  • Excellent English communication (written + spoken)
  • Comfortable monitoring dashboards, logs, and basic troubleshooting
  • Organized, process-driven, and proactive in follow-through
  • Able to work full EST hours
  • Fast learner with strong tech adaptability

Nice to Have: SaaS experience, robotics/automation familiarity, vendor portal coordination, or experience delivering online client training.

Success Metrics (KPIs)
  • Customer satisfaction scores (CSAT/NPS)
  • Number of client referrals
  • Healthy robot utilization levels
  • Smooth 30/60-day follow-ups and deployment operations
  • Quality of upsell leads
  • Reduced Tier-1 escalations


  • Philippines Monetate Full time ₱1,000,000 - ₱2,000,000 per year

    About This RoleAs a Customer Success Manager at Monetate, you'll drive customer retention, loyalty, and satisfaction by delivering exceptional value through our solutions. You'll manage multiple accounts, act as a trusted advisor, and collaborate cross-functionally with sales, services, and support teams to ensure customers maximize the platform's impact....


  • Philippines Activate Talent Full time ₱50,000 - ₱150,000 per year

    Overview We're seeking a proactive and relationship-driven Customer Success Manager to manage a portfolio of brands and ensure they achieve measurable growth and long-term success on our platform. You'll work closely with founders, marketers, and brand teams—helping them stay active, uncover opportunities, expand usage, and drive revenue. This is a...


  • , , Philippines Icon Full time

    Icon is looking for a dependable customer success manager to keep projects moving, align teams, and make sure client feedback turns into on‑time, high‑quality deliverables. You’ll coordinate across creators, editors, and the script team, run clear communication, and keep stakeholders informed. What You’ll Do Serve as the primary point of contact for...


  • , , Philippines Yngen Datacom Corp. Full time

    2 days ago Be among the first 25 applicants Get AI-powered advice on this job and more exclusive features. Welcome to Yngen Datacom Corp. where outsourcing meets excellence and innovation. As pioneers in the BPO sector, we redefine efficiency and elevate client satisfaction through our comprehensive suite of services. Our dedicated team of industry experts...


  • Philippines Pulse iD Full time $30,000 - $60,000 per year

    Role OverviewWe are seeking a Junior Customer Success Manager (CSM) based in the Philippines, who will play a key role in driving customer success, retention, and growth across Pulse iD's portfolio of banking and enterprise clients.This role combines strategic account management, marketing partnership enablement, and loyalty program optimization. You will...


  • , , Philippines reesmarx Full time

    Responsibilities Build strong relationships with all your customers, from team members to executives. Regularly engage with them to understand their business objectives, goals, decision‑making processes, and budgeting cycles. Stay connected as organizational changes occur. Collaborate closely with the Customer Organization, including the APAC team, peer...


  • , , Philippines Refinitiv Full time

    # **Our Privacy Statement & Cookie Policy****Customer Success Manager - AEM****About the role:**Job Summary:* The Customer Success Manager will be responsible for all post-sales support activities related to software products sold by TR Legal (Philippines). This role involves working closely with customers, partners and internal stakeholders to ensure...


  • , , Philippines Refinitiv Full time

    # **Our Privacy Statement & Cookie Policy****Manager, Customer Success Management - AEM****About the Role:*** Responsibility for providing leadership and team management for the CSM team supporting low-mid market customers across the AEM region* Manage the delivery of the customer service experience, drive customer retention, identify growth potential and...


  • , Central Luzon, Philippines Aspen Technology Full time

    The driving force behind our success has always been the people of AspenTech. What drives us, is our aspiration, our desire and ambition to keep pushing the envelope, overcoming any hurdle, challenging the status quo to continually find a better way. You will experience these qualities of passion, pride and aspiration in many ways — from a rich set of...


  • , , Philippines Meltwater Group Full time

    Begin your career as a Customer Success Manager at Meltwater, where each day is dedicated to ensuring the continued success and satisfaction of our valued customers. We're searching for driven individuals to join our team and play a pivotal role in delivering exceptional experiences. As a Customer Success Manager, your focus will be on driving impactful...